Sorting in the Quillbase report builder is stable as of v4.2. Rows with equal sort keys keep their original insert order. Before v4.2 ties were reordered arbitrarily, so customers comparing old and new exports may report "shuffled" rows — that's expected, not a bug. Don't file tickets for tie-order differences across versions. If a customer needs deterministic output on older builds, tell them to add a secondary sort on row ID. Verified builds are signed; check exports against the key below.

rollout seal: bky4_x7Gc

## Date Localization — Plugin Onboarding

All Fernwick plugins must render dates via the LocaleBridge helper. Do not format dates manually; user locale settings override plugin defaults. Supported patterns live in the `datefmt` table of the shared config store. Register your plugin's default pattern at install time, then read back the resolved value on each request. To verify your patterns against the live table, connect to the staging config database using the credentials below.

replica DSN, kajep-yahag: mssql://praok_svc:iF@db-8d68.plorvaio.local:5432/eliion

Handover Note — Project Lanternway

To branch managers, from outgoing director M. Carraway to incoming director E. Voss. Lanternway, our internal scheduling platform, is eight months behind; causes were vendor turnover at Brindle Softworks and scope added mid-build. Phase one testing resumes next month at the Oakhurst branch. Please hold local workarounds until Voss issues revised timelines. Staffing and budget files are with the programme office. The confidential planning note follows below.

internal memo for fawef-tafof: Headcount on the Holath team goes from 48 to 102 by the end of January. Gross margin on Holath came in at 5 percent against a plan of 36 percent.